As far as the clothing Kate may wear, we share outstanding insight from a recent story by The Canadian Press. Writer Lauren La Rose spoke with Barbara Atkin of Canadian luxury retailer Holt Renfrew. Ms. Atkin offers a few tips on what to look for:
- “She’s going to have a wardrobe of wonderful shirts (that) she’s going to wear casually or elegantly tucked with a jacket.”
- “Kate will also need luncheon-type looks like a printed or coloured dress paired with a cardigan along with more high-fashion attire for gala events, Atkin noted. And expect to see a topper or two, with Kate sporting a fascinator or wide-brimmed hat to round out her look.”
- “Atkin anticipates the duchess will opt for a variety of jackets and some of her go-to style staples like jeans and comfortable wedge shoes for her more casual outfits during the visit.”
The Canadian Press story also featured input from Sarah Casselman, a senior editor at Canada’s Fashion Magazine. Among Ms. Casselman’s ideas:
- “Kate typically goes for “power pigments” like brick red and bright blue, and that she has always been consistent with her style.”
- “Casselman hopes to see Kate go patriotic in red and white for Canada Day on Parliament Hill.”
- ” In terms of a homegrown designer she feels would complement Kate’s style, Casselman suggests longtime womenswear designer Lida Baday.”

Back to Ms. La Rose’s story:
“Both Atkin and Casselman think jackets from Canadian design duo Smythe would also be a good fit.
“(They) have those fantastic, fitted blazers, and tweed herringbone pieces” again, perfect for that horse and hound set,” Casselman said. “You could just see her strolling on the weekend with her Starbucks wearing skinny jeans and one of Smythe’s jackets with the elbow patches on them.”
